Details: The LCD settlement will resolve a class action lawsuit [titled In re: TFT-LCD (Flat Panel) Antitrust Litigation, MDL NO. 1827] accusing 10 LCD manufacturers of entering a price-fixing scheme to fix, maintain and raise the prices of LCD panels.  The companies involved in the case are: Toshiba, LG, AU Optronics, Samsung, Sharp, Hitachi, Epson, Chimei, Chunghwa and HannStar.

Under the terms of the LCD price-fixing settlement, the companies will pay a combined $1.1 billion to consumers in 24 states and Washington, D.C. that purchased a laptop, computer monitor or television with a flat-panel LCD display between January 1, 1999 and December 31, 2006 manufactured by one of these companies.

The LCD class action settlement only covers consumers who purchased INDIRECTLY from these companies. “Indirectly” means that you purchased an LCD panel in a television, monitor or notebook computer from someone other than the manufacturer of that panel (such as at Best Buy, Amazon.com, etc.). The amount of money you can receive from the LCD price-fixing settlement will depend on the number of products purchased and the number of valid Claim Forms filed. According to the Settlement Administrator website, however, this amount could be anywhere from $25 to $200 or more.

The only way to receive money from the LCD class action lawsuit settlement is to submit a valid Claim Form by the deadline of December 6, 2012.

Claim Forms and more information on your rights in the LCD Panel Price-Fixing Class Action Lawsuit Settlement can be found at www.LCDClass.com. The Final Fairness Hearing is scheduled for November 29, 2012.
